In modern food packaging, maintaining product freshness, safety and quality throughout the supply chain is a critical challenge. Oxygen, moisture and external contamination can accelerate product deterioration, reduce shelf life and affect consumer experience.
High barrier films for food packaging provide an effective solution by controlling the transmission of oxygen and moisture while maintaining excellent mechanical strength and sealing performance.
Advanced multilayer co-extruded films combine different polymer materials into a single structure, allowing each layer to perform a specific function. These technologies help food manufacturers achieve reliable packaging performance for applications such as vacuum packaging, modified atmosphere packaging (MAP) and thermoforming.
High barrier films are multilayer flexible packaging materials designed to reduce the transmission of gases, moisture and other external factors that may affect product quality.
Different polymer materials provide different functions:
| Material | Main Function |
|---|---|
| EVOH | Excellent oxygen barrier protection |
| PA | Mechanical strength and puncture resistance |
| PE | Heat sealing, flexibility and moisture resistance |
| PP | Temperature resistance and stiffness |
In advanced packaging applications, these materials can be combined through multilayer co-extrusion technology to create structures ranging from 3-layer to 11-layer films.
A typical high barrier structure may include:
Barrier layers for oxygen protection
Mechanical layers for durability
Sealing layers for package integrity
Tie layers for interlayer adhesion
Oxygen exposure can cause:
Oxidation
Color changes
Flavor loss
Reduced shelf life
By controlling Oxygen Transmission Rate (OTR) and Water Vapor Transmission Rate (WVTR), high barrier films help protect sensitive food products during storage and transportation.

EVOH is one of the most effective polymer-based oxygen barrier materials used in flexible packaging.
Because EVOH is moisture sensitive, it is normally protected by surrounding layers such as PE or PA.
A well-designed EVOH structure provides:
Excellent oxygen resistance
Extended shelf life
Improved product protection
PA provides:
High toughness
Puncture resistance
Tensile strength
Durability
Therefore, PA-containing structures are commonly used for demanding applications such as vacuum packaging and thermoforming.
PE provides:
Reliable heat sealing
Flexibility
Moisture resistance
It is commonly used as the inner sealing layer in food packaging structures.
